Antler Handle Knives: Where History Meets Utility
The rugged allure of antler handle knives has captivated enthusiasts for generations. These handcrafted implements combine the timeless elegance of natural materials with the practical demands of everyday use. For centuries, skilled artisans have meticulously selected and shaped antlers from various species, creating handles that are both aesthetically pleasing and incredibly durable. The inherent strength and resilience of antler make it an ideal choice for knife handles, ensuring years of reliable service.
- Each antler handle is one-of-a-kind, showcasing the intricate patterns and natural variations inherent in the material.
- Furthermore, the warm, inviting texture of antler provides a comfortable and secure grip, even when hands are damp or slick.
